For the 2025-26 school year, there is 1 private school serving 43 students in Woodville, TX (there are 4 public schools, serving 1,215 public students). 3% of all K-12 students in Woodville, TX are educated in private schools (compared to the TX state average of 6%).
The top ranked private school in Woodville, TX is St. Paul's Episcopal School.
The average acceptance rate is 25%, which is lower than the Texas private school average acceptance rate of 82%.
100% of private schools in Woodville, TX are religiously affiliated (most commonly Episcopal).
